Introduction
A leading global financial services firm sought a robust system to conduct pre-trade checks on orders from Private Wealth Management clients to ensure regulatory compliance. The firm recognized the criticality of this requirement and engaged Wissen to develop a solution that could execute pre-trade checks efficiently and transparently.
Analyzing the Problem
- Need for pre-trade checks for private wealth management orders
- Regulatory compliance mandates
- Requirement for transparency and auditability
Initial Challenges
- Absence of an efficient pre-trade checking system
- Complexity in setting up and managing rules
- Lack of transparency and audit trail
Our Solution
- Wissen's technical experts devised a solution focused on speed, transparency, and ease of use:
- Development of an ultra-fast pre-trade engine based on ANTLR
- Design and implementation of a custom domain-specific language (DSL) for rule setup
- Creation of an intuitive and transparent system for rule execution and management
Key Results Achieved
- Implementation of an extremely fast pre-trade engine
- Introduction of a custom DSL for easy rule setup by end-users
- Enhanced transparency and auditability in rule execution
- Simplified management and retrieval of audit trails for regulatory reporting
Conclusion
Wissen's innovative approach to developing a streamlined pre-trade checking system has enabled our client to meet regulatory compliance requirements efficiently. By leveraging cutting-edge technologies such as ANTLR and custom DSL, we have provided end-users with a user-friendly platform for setting up, managing, and transparently executing pre-trade rules. This solution not only enhances compliance but also empowers end-users to author rules independently, thereby ensuring regulatory adherence with ease.